What tune is “Who’s that team we call the Arsenal” sung to?
“Who’s that team we call the Arsenal” chant is sung to the popular song “God save Ireland” by Timothy Daniel Sullivan way back in 1867. The chant takes inspiration from the chorus of “God save Ireland” hence the catchiness of the chant.
